本科课件-离散数学(完整).ppt

运算共性的研究(如何理解一个新的运算) 运算 基本概念 基本性质 一元运算:对合律等 二元运算:交换律、结合律等 与比较运算的关系 与其他运算的关系 对性质的封闭性 关系复合运算的性质 定理5.4.4 设R是A到B的二元关系,IA,IB分别是A和B上的相等关系,则 IA·R=R·IB=R 例:令A={1,2,3}, B={a,b,c,d} 1。 2。 3。 A IA 。 。 。 B a b c 。 d R 1。 2。 3。 A R IB 。 。 。 a b c 。 d 。 。 。 B a b c 。 d 1。 2。 3。 A B 定理5.4.5 设R1是从A到B的关系,R2和R3是从B到C的关系,R4是从C到D的关系,则 若R2?R3 那么 R1R2?R1R3且 R2R4?R3R4 R1(R2∪R3)=R1R2∪R1R3 (R2∪R3)R4=R2R4∪R3R4 R1(R2∩R3)?R1R2∩R1R3 (R2∩R3)R4?R2R4∩R3R4 (R1R2)-1?R2-1R1-1 证明(1) ?a,c? R1R2 则?b,b ?B使得 aR1b 且 bR2c ∵ R2 ? R3 ∴ bR3c 即a,c? R1R3 ∴ R1R2 ? R1R3 类似可证R2R4 ? R3R4 证明(2) 任取a,c∈R1(R2∪R3) ? ?b(b∈B∧a,b∈R1∧b,c∈R2∪R3) ??b(b∈B∧a,b∈R1∧(b,c∈R2∨b,c∈R3)) ??b((b∈B∧a,b∈R1∧b,c∈R2)∨ (b∈B∧a,b∈R1∧b,c∈R3)) ??b(b∈B∧a,b∈R1∧b,c∈R2)∨ ?b(b∈B∧a,b∈R1∧b,c∈R3) ?a,c∈R1R2∨a,c∈R1R3 ?a,c∈(R1R2)∪(R1R3) 所以R1(R2∪R3)=(R1R2)∪(R1R3) 证明(4) 任取a,c∈R1 (R2∩R3) ? ?b(b∈B∧a,b∈R1∧b,c∈R2∩ R3) ??b(b∈B∧a,b∈R1∧(b,c∈R2∧b,c∈ R3)) ??b((b∈B∧a,b∈R1∧b,c∈R2) ∧ (b∈B∧a,b∈R1∧b,c∈ R3)) ??b(b∈B∧a,b∈R1∧b,c∈R2)∧ ?b(b∈B∧a,b∈R1∧b,c∈ R3) ?a,c∈R1R2 ∧a,c∈R1 R3 ?a,c∈(R1R2)∩(R1R3) 所以 R1 (R2∩ R3)?(R1R2)∩(R1R3) 定理5.4.6 设R1和R2是由A到B的关系, S1和S2是由B到C的关系,若 R1 ? R2 , S1 ? S2 ,则 R1S1 ? R2S2 定理5.4.7 设R1是从A到B的关系,R2是从B到C的关系,R3是从C到D的关系,则 (R1R2)R3=R1(R2R3) (复合运算满足结合律) 证明:?a,d∈R1 (R2 R3) ??b(b∈B∧a,b∈ R1 ∧b,d∈ R2 R3) ??b(b∈B∧a,b∈ R1 ∧?c(c∈C∧b,c∈ R2 ∧c,d∈ R3)) ??b?c(b∈B∧a,b∈ R1 ∧(c∈C∧b,c∈ R2 ∧c,d∈ R3)) ??c?b(c∈C∧(b∈B∧a,b∈ R1 ∧b,c∈ R2 ∧c,d∈ R3)) ??c (c∈C∧?b(b∈B∧a,b∈ R1 ∧b,c∈ R2)∧c,d∈ R3) ??c (c∈C∧a,c∈ R1 R2)∧c,d∈ R3) ?a,d∈(R1 R2) R3 关系R的幂 当R是A上的一个关系时,R可与自身合成任意次而形成A上的一个新关系,即 RR=R2, R2R=RR2 =R3,… 定义5.4.4 设R是集合A上的二元关系,n∈N,那么R的n次幂记为Rn,定义如下: (1) R0 =IA (2) Rn=Rn-1·R 定理5.4.8 设R是A上的关系, m,n ∈Z,那么 (1) (Rn)-1=(R-1) n (2) Rm·Rn=Rm+n (3) (Rm)n=Rmn 定理5.4.9 设R是n元有限集A上的关系,那么?s,t?Z,使Rs=Rt而 0≤s<t≤ 证明:为方便起见,记 因为总共只有m个定义在n元有限集A上的不同的关系,所以 以下m+1个R的方幂 R0, R1, R2,…, Rm 之中,必有相同者。所以存在s和t, 0≤s<t≤m 使 Rs=Rt 鸽巢原理(抽屉原则) 定理5.4.10 设R是集合A上的一个二元关系.若?s,t?Z, s<t,使Rs=Rt.记p=t-s,那么 (a) 对所有i?Z, Rs+i=Rt+i (b) 对所有k,i ?Z, Rs+kp+i=Rs+i

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档